Mapping cancer spread to guide safer rectal surgery

NCT ID NCT07202169

Summary

This study aims to understand how low rectal cancer spreads within the bowel wall at different stages. Researchers examined 106 patients to determine how far cancer cells spread from the main tumor, which helps surgeons decide how much healthy tissue to remove during surgery. The findings provide guidance for creating more precise surgical plans to improve patient outcomes and quality of life.
